The Cast of Alf NOW: Where Are They Really?

The cast of Alf now commands attention across streaming platforms and retrospective features, as fans revisit the iconic 1980s sitcom with renewed interest. This ensemble brings warmth, humor, and distinct chemistry that continues to define the show’s legacy.

Below is a structured overview of the main cast members, their roles, and key details that highlight their contributions to Alf.

Cast Member Character Played First Appeared Notable Traits
Paul Fusco Alf (voice) 1986 Puppeteer, creator, witty narrator
Max Wright Willie Tanner 1986 Patented straight man, steady father figure
Anne Schedeen Kate Tanner 1986 Compassionate mother, patient anchor
Andrea Elson Lynn Tanner 1986 Older daughter, sarcastic yet loyal
Benji Gregory Brian Tanner 1986 Younger son, earnest and curious
John LaMotta Mr. Peterson 1986 Neighbor foil with dry delivery

The Heart Behind the Puppet: Paul Fusco and the Cast Dynamic

Paul Fusco is the creative nucleus of Alf, operating the puppetry and voicing the extraterrestrial with unmatched personality. His influence shapes every scene, ensuring that Alf remains both mischievous and endearing to viewers.

The on-screen chemistry among the Tanner family cast members feels authentic, turning everyday domestic moments into memorable television. This authentic familial bond anchors the show’s comedy and heart.

Family Roles: The Tanner Household

Willie and Kate Tanner

Max Wright and Anne Schedeen embody the grounded parents who navigate chaos with dry humor and genuine care. Their steady presence helps frame Alf’s antics within relatable family life.

Lynn and Brian Tanner

Andrea Elson and Benji Gregory provide generational contrast, with Lynn’s sarcasm and Brian’s innocence highlighting different responses to Alf’s disruptive charm. Together, they reflect sibling dynamics that resonate across audiences.

FAQ

Reader questions

Who provides the voice and puppetry for Alf?

Paul Fusco serves as both the puppeteer and primary voice of Alf, directing the character’s personality through performance and recording.

Which actor plays the father, Willie Tanner, in the series?

Max Wright plays Willie Tanner, delivering a memorable portrayal of a patient, sometimes exasperated yet loving father.

How do the child actors contribute to the show’s dynamic?

Andrea Elson and Benji Gregory bring authentic sibling chemistry as Lynn and Brian, balancing humor with heartfelt moments in the Tanner household.
